Specialized equipment and trailers for crane hauling

Cranes (Mobile & Crawler) often require more than a standard flatbed. Depending on the configuration, our fleet may use RGNs, lowboys, step decks, double drops, or multi-axle trailers to manage height, weight, and center of gravity. Crawlers can bring concentrated weight and wide tracks, while mobile cranes may include boom sections, counterweights, and attachments that change the load profile. Heavy Haulers evaluate whether the move needs deck height reduction, rear loading access, or extra axle spread to protect pavement and stay within permit limits. We also account for dismantled components that may ship separately when a full crane cannot move as one piece. Heavy Haul Transporting matches the trailer to the machine, not the other way around. That matters when the load must clear local bridges, turn through port-area streets, or travel on interstate routes with height restrictions. The right trailer choice reduces surprises and keeps the road move controlled from pickup to delivery.

Permits, escort requirements, and route planning in Connecticut

Connecticut oversize moves demand careful planning, especially when a crane leaves Port of New London, CT and heads onto regional highways. Route work often considers I-95, I-395, Route 32, Route 2, and connections toward the Massachusetts line or the New York corridor. Height, width, and gross weight all affect the permit path, and bridge clearances can change the route fast. Heavy Haulers review axle spacing, load dimensions, and turning radius before dispatch so the truck does not get boxed into tight city streets or low-clearance overpasses. Depending on the load, escorts may be required for width, length, or visibility, and some routes need daylight travel or restricted travel windows. Heavy Haulers also coordinate route surveys when a crane’s boom, counterweight, or crawler base pushes the move into more complex territory. That level of planning protects the machine, the driver, and the roadway while keeping the move compliant with Connecticut rules.
